综合物探方法在锰矿勘查中的应用

摘    要:锰矿的物理性质和化学性质一般与围岩没有明显差异,决定了锰矿的勘探难度.尤其是埋深较大、后期改造强烈的矿床,勘探难度更大.在陕南汉中宁强一处锰矿勘查中,利用传统物探手段,打破常规勘探思路,利用综合物探方法,最后取得较为理想结果.实例结果说明,地面高精度磁测不能简单地认为一定有要有传统理念意义上的磁性差异,关键的问题在于如何去应用和解释;火山沉积型锰矿也不是传统思想上的没有激电异常,而是有足够强的信号,完全可以根据激电异常指导深部地质勘查工作.同时,还要注意到,深部地质勘查工作离不开综合物探勘查技术.大胆使用综合物探勘查技术,才可能提出新的找矿勘查空间和新的找矿勘查方向.

Abstract:There is little difference between the physical and chemical properties of manganese orebodies and those of their wallrocks. That means the exploration for manganese deposits is difficult, especially for those with deep burial and intense reformation. In the manganese prospecting in Ningqiang area of Shaanxi Province, with traditional geophysical measures but unconventional ideas, a satisfied result is obtained. The practice shows that the magnetic difference is not necessarily desired for high-precision ground magnetic survey. The key is to apply and explain properly. The volcanic sedimentary type of manganese deposits is not without IP anomaly as that described by traditional theory. Instead, the IP signal is strong enough to guide deep exploration.
